在訪問現在很火的google plus時,細心的用戶也許會發現頁面之間的點擊是通過ajax異步請求的,同時頁面的URL發生了了改變。並且能夠很好的支持瀏覽器的前進和后退。不禁讓人想問,是什么有這么強大的功能呢 HTML 里引用了新的API,就是history.pushState和history.replaceState,就是通過這個接口做到無刷新改變頁面URL的。 與傳統的AJAX的區別 傳統的a ...
2015-10-13 14:54 0 5602 推薦指數:
發現一個可以改變地址欄,而不導致頁面刷新的東東。 Chrome, FF測試通過,不支持IE. 實現目標 頁面的跳轉(前進后退,點擊等)不重新請求頁面 頁面URL與頁面展現內容一致(符合人們對傳統網頁的認識) 在不支持的瀏覽器下降級成傳統網頁的方式 使用到的API ...
如何使用ajax實現無刷新改變頁面內容(也就是ajax異步請求刷新頁面),下面通過一個小demo說明一下,前端頁面代碼如下所示 說明:這個頁面需要實現的功能是,后台通過sql查詢數據庫,根據返回結果,前端用ajax訪問后台方法返回值,彈出蒙層1,或者蒙層 ...
:ajax可以實現頁面的局部刷新,可以做到非常奈斯的數據加載效果,給用戶帶來非常良好的體驗,但是ajax的 ...
在完成畢業設計(基於Vue的信息資訊展示與管理平台)的過程中,處理如下圖所示的 點擊左側欄目列表跳轉到對應文章列表 的問題時,初次點擊可以跳轉到對應的頁面,但是當第二次點擊時,雖然地址欄的參數改變了,也沒有重新刷新頁面中的內容。 第1次,點擊“潮科技”時顯示的內容: 第2次 ...
使用 history.replaceState(null, "title","arg"); 例如: history.replaceState(null, "",'?category_id=0'+'&page='+pageIndex); ...
參考:http://www.jquerycn.cn/a_10532 ...
使用JavaScript修改瀏覽器URL地址欄 現在主流的瀏覽器,可以在不刷新頁面的情況下修改瀏覽器URL;在瀏覽過程中,可以將瀏覽歷史儲存起來,當在瀏覽器點擊后退按鈕時,可以沖瀏覽歷史上獲得回退的信息。 本文就介紹下它是如何工作的。 復制代碼代碼示例: var ...